01 · Attendance Registers
Every class keeps a weekly signature register. Preview it before printing, or download it straight away.
Weekly register — view or download
Produces the full UIF-style register for one class, one week: header block, five-day signature grid, and footer note.
- Open Attendance from the left-hand menu.
- Pick the class from the — select a class — dropdown.
- Land on the right week using ← Prev week, This week, Next week →, or the date field.
- Click View register (PDF) to open it in a new tab first, or go straight to Download register (PDF) to save it.
02 · Learner Masterlist
One workbook covering every learner, grouped Municipality → Site → Class, with a built-in compliance summary sheet.
Export Excel
Downloads exactly what's on screen — apply filters and pick columns first if you only need a slice of the full list.
- Open Learner Masterlist.
- Narrow the list if needed — Municipality, Status, Class, free-text search, and a start-date range are all available in the filter bar.
- Use Columns to choose which of the 15 available fields appear in the export.
- Click Export Excel. The file downloads as
Learner_Masterlist_{date}.xlsx.
03 · Payslips & Stipends
Three related exports live on this page, all reading from the same filtered list of learners for a given month.
Before generating any of the three reports: set Month, Municipality, Class, Learner Status, Payment Status, and stipend bracket at the top of the page. Each export uses whatever is currently on screen.

Stipend register
Export CSV
A ready-to-import Sage Payroll file — employee number, names, ID, dates, UIF/tax status, bank details, days worked, and stipend amount.
- Click Export CSV, top-right.
- File downloads as
stipend-{year}-{month}.csv.

Bulk payment
Standard Bank Bulk
A Standard Bank bulk-payment batch file, one row per learner.
- Click Standard Bank Bulk.
- Enter your Standard Bank from-account number when prompted — it's remembered for next time.
- File downloads as
standard-bank-bulk-{year}-{month}.csv.
Note: only learners with a bank account number, branch code, and a stipend above R0 are included. Anyone excluded is listed in the confirmation message so you can chase up their banking details. -
Per learner
Individual payslip
A single-page PDF payslip for one learner — earnings, UIF/tax deductions, and nett pay.
- Find the learner's row in the table.
- Click the ⬇ PDF button at the end of their row.
- File downloads as
payslip-{ID number}-{year}-{month}.pdf.
04 · Compliance Reports
Tracks six fields per learner — Banking Details, UIF Reference No., ID Numbers, Tax Reference No., Contracts, and Highest Qualification — each as Verified, Unverified, or Missing.
Full compliance workbook
All six fields, for every learner, in one workbook — a Summary sheet plus a full learner-by-learner data sheet.
- Set the learner-status filter, top-left, if you don't want "All Learners".
- Click Download Excel, top-right.
- Admins are asked to choose All Municipalities or one specific municipality before the file generates. Facilitators don't see this step — their export is automatically scoped to their own classes.
One field at a time
Every card has its own Export button, and drilling into a card lets you scope that same field down to a single municipality, training venue, or class.
- To export one field for the whole organisation (or, as a facilitator, all your classes): click Export directly on its card.
- To narrow it further: click "Click to explore →" on the card to open the municipality breakdown.
- Click a municipality's own Export button for that municipality only, or click the municipality name to drill into its training venues.
- Keep drilling — venue → class — each level has its own Export, scoped to exactly what's on screen.
